<title>eCryptfs: Filename Encryption: mount option</title>

Enable mount-wide filename encryption by providing the Filename Encryption
Key (FNEK) signature as a mount option.  Note that the ecryptfs-utils
userspace package versions 61 or later support this option.

When mounting with ecryptfs-utils version 61 or later, the mount helper
will detect the availability of the passphrase-based filename encryption
in the kernel (via the eCryptfs sysfs handle) and query the user
interactively as to whether or not he wants to enable the feature for the
mount.  If the user enables filename encryption, the mount helper will
then prompt for the FNEK signature that the user wishes to use, suggesting
by default the signature for the mount passphrase that the user has
already entered for encrypting the file contents.

When not using the mount helper, the user can specify the signature for
the passphrase key with the ecryptfs_fnek_sig= mount option.  This key
must be available in the user's keyring.  The mount helper usually takes
care of this step.  If, however, the user is not mounting with the mount
helper, then he will need to enter the passphrase key into his keyring
with some other utility prior to mounting, such as ecryptfs-manager.

<title>eCryptfs: Filename Encryption: Encoding and encryption functions</title>

These functions support encrypting and encoding the filename contents.
The encrypted filename contents may consist of any ASCII characters.  This
patch includes a custom encoding mechanism to map the ASCII characters to
a reduced character set that is appropriate for filenames.

<title>eCryptfs: Filename Encryption: Tag 70 packets</title>

This patchset implements filename encryption via a passphrase-derived
mount-wide Filename Encryption Key (FNEK) specified as a mount parameter.
Each encrypted filename has a fixed prefix indicating that eCryptfs should
try to decrypt the filename.  When eCryptfs encounters this prefix, it
decodes the filename into a tag 70 packet and then decrypts the packet
contents using the FNEK, setting the filename to the decrypted filename.
Both unencrypted and encrypted filenames can reside in the same lower
filesystem.

Because filename encryption expands the length of the filename during the
encoding stage, eCryptfs will not properly handle filenames that are
already near the maximum filename length.

In the present implementation, eCryptfs must be able to produce a match
against the lower encrypted and encoded filename representation when given
a plaintext filename.  Therefore, two files having the same plaintext name
will encrypt and encode into the same lower filename if they are both
encrypted using the same FNEK.  This can be changed by finding a way to
replace the prepended bytes in the blocked-aligned filename with random
characters; they are hashes of the FNEK right now, so that it is possible
to deterministically map from a plaintext filename to an encrypted and
encoded filename in the lower filesystem.  An implementation using random
characters will have to decode and decrypt every single directory entry in
any given directory any time an event occurs wherein the VFS needs to
determine whether a particular file exists in the lower directory and the
decrypted and decoded filenames have not yet been extracted for that
directory.
